Meaning of Inarah:
Inarah is a feminine name with Arabic origins. It is derived from the Arabic word 'anwar', meaning 'radiant' or 'illuminating'. Inarah symbolizes a person who brings light and positivity wherever she goes. She has a magnetic personality and has the ability to uplift and inspire others.
